Tribal Food Sovereignty In The American Southwest, Julia Guarino Jun 2021

Tribal Food Sovereignty In The American Southwest, Julia Guarino

Journal of Food Law & Policy

Food is an issue that implicates tribal sovereignty for historical, cultural, and public health reasons. This article undertakes a policy analysis of the importance of food to tribal sovereignty, and suggests that tribes, many of which have begun to do so already, make robust use of the concept of "food sovereignty" as part of their overarching project of protecting and promoting tribal sovereignty in general.
